Step 1: Figure Out Your Gig

The first step you need to take, before doing anything, is to figure out what type of side gig you want to go into.

There are probably over a million things you can do; however, you probably want to start with things that you are good at.

You should ask yourself:

  • What do I enjoy doing?
  • What am I good at?
  • How educated am I on the subject?
  • Are there people already doing it and making money?

These questions are important because they will help you focus on what your side gig could be.

For me, I decided to be a freelance writer on the side, I was already writing heavily for my own blog Simply Insurance, and I also happen to be in the very niche insurance space.

I decided that my side gig would consist of me being a freelance insurance and personal finance writer.

I created a Hire Me page on my own personal blog that showcased my writing skills with articles.

Now that I knew what I wanted to do, my next step was to figure out how to make it happen.

Step 2: Get Educated

Education is the most critical factor when it comes to anything that you do.

While I have over 11 years of insurance knowledge, I didn’t know the first thing about being a freelance writer.

The first thing I did was to get an education on it from a professional, so I purchased their course on how to make money with freelance writing.

The thing you must remember is that going to a traditional “School” for education isn’t always going to be the answer.

There is no one that you can learn from, better than someone already doing it and most of these courses aren’t expensive at all.

My course only cost me $200.00 and several hours of my time. I think it was well worth it seeing that it is has given me a substantial side-gig income.

If you don’t take anything from this post, just take away the fact that you shouldn’t do anything until you get educated on it.

Step 3: Outreach

Like any type of business, once you get educated and know what is expected, you need to start reaching out to people for work.

You can use several platforms, but for me I used:

LinkedIn Pro-Finder

This option was great for me because people search for local writers to create things like books, blog posts, and ghostwriting jobs. Once the job is posted, you get to submit your proposal, and I was able to get some work through the LinkedIn Pro-finder tool.

Facebook Groups

Joining Facebook groups that are a part of your industry is essential. Over 60% of my jobs have come from people in Facebook groups that need my writing skills or from people in the group who can’t take on extra work and pass it along.

Becoming part of a community is very important, you can learn extra skills and also build relationships that help you get your side gig to the next level.

Problogger Job Board

Job boards are also a great way to find work, especially when you are first starting your side gig. For me, Problogger has a job board all about freelance writing so I can apply for jobs as I want daily.

Finding your mix of places on where to get jobs will be different, but using the above Ideas help you get on the fast track to building a steady side gig.

Step 4: Consistent Work

When you first start off, you probably won’t get top-dollar for any of your work, unless, like me, you are in a very specialized niche.

This is perfectly fine, you need to get some work under your belt and prove you can do the job. I used my portfolio of articles from my site and some guest posts that I had written in the past as proof of my work. A lesson I learned from the course I took was that you should set a daily goal and that would help you get to your monthly goal.

To make $7,000 per month, I needed to do $233.00 worth of freelance work per day. This work comes from both individuals and corporations, and in general, I am able to create the income that I want.

The best thing is that I can actually get ahead on my work and not do anything else in regards to freelance writing for the rest of the month. My average post is around 1,000 words, so it isn’t much to do more than one post per day if I wanted.

At what point does a side hustle become a business? ›

As soon as you start earning money in your side hustle, you're a business and considered a “sole proprietor.” Simply, any individual who provides a service and collects money from it is a sole proprietor. Many businesses start this way and many don't need to be anything else.

What is the best business structure for a side hustle? ›

Sole proprietor – A sole proprietorship is the simplest form of entity. If your services are covered by an appropriate malpractice policy, it's also probably the best choice for you. In essence, there are no special filings except maybe a local business license.

How much money can you make on a side hustle without paying taxes? ›

Frequently asked questions (FAQs) How much can you make from a side job before you need to pay taxes? The IRS states that anyone making $400 or more in net income from a side hustle must file an annual tax return and pay income taxes.
